About Tynemouth Longsands

Tynemouth Longsands is a dog-friendly walk in Tynemouth, Tynemouth & Whitley Bay. Dogs banned from southern section 1 May to 30 Sep; northern end open all year.

As a dog-friendly walk near Tynemouth & Whitley Bay, it's a good spot to stretch your dog's legs. Check local signage for lead rules, livestock and any seasonal restrictions, and clear up after your dog to keep it welcoming for everyone.
